1979 Buick Century vs. 1973 GMC Jimmy
To start off, 1979 Buick Century is newer by 6 year(s). Which means there will be less support and parts availability for 1973 GMC Jimmy. In addition, the cost of maintenance, including insurance, on 1973 GMC Jimmy would be higher. At 4,093 cc (6 cylinders), 1973 GMC Jimmy is equipped with a bigger engine. In terms of performance, 1979 Buick Century (104 HP @ 4000 RPM) has 3 more horse power than 1973 GMC Jimmy. (101 HP @ 3600 RPM). In normal driving conditions, 1979 Buick Century should accelerate faster than 1973 GMC Jimmy. With that said, vehicle weight also plays an important factor in acceleration. 1973 GMC Jimmy weights approximately 370 kg more than 1979 Buick Century.
Because 1973 GMC Jimmy is four wheel drive (4WD), it will have significant more traction and grip than 1979 Buick Century. In wet, icy, snow, or gravel driving conditions, 1973 GMC Jimmy will offer significantly more control. With that said, do keep in mind that many other factors such as speed and the wear on your tires can also have significant impact on traction and control. Let's talk about torque, 1973 GMC Jimmy (242 Nm @ 1600 RPM) has 24 more torque (in Nm) than 1979 Buick Century. (218 Nm @ 2000 RPM). This means 1973 GMC Jimmy will have an easier job in driving up hills or pulling heavy equipment than 1979 Buick Century.
